We’re not done with the single leg work yet.  Today bring back the Single Leg Romanian Deadlift.  As confusing as it might sound, it’s essentially a hip hinge (or “good morning”) on one leg.  Here is a demo video with both good form and then two examples of common faults.  The first fault you’ll notice is a collapse of torso stability (the spine starts to round).  You’ll notice she bends her back knee also in this version, which isn’t the worst thing and can actually make some of our points of performance more accessible.  The second fault she demos is a rotation of the pelvis (the lifted leg twists open).  This might feel easier, but it’s completely skipping over the activation that we’re trying to find.

The details make all the difference on this one.  Don’t worry – if it feels a bit heady, the dumbell thrusters and hurdle sprints will bring you back into the physical world quite readily.
